The interest rates charged by banks are influenced heavily by the decisions of the Federal Reserve.

The Federal Reserve known as the "Fed" can manipulate interest rates by buying and selling bonds in the bond markets. During economic times the Fed wants to stimulate the market, the Fed buys bonds on the open market, and pays for the bonds with cash. If the Fed continues buy bonds, the market becomes flooded with cash. This excess cash in turn makes money more available for people who want to borrow. The result is interest rates will naturally come down as different lenders compete for a limited pool of borrowers.

Stop for a moment and think out all this excess available cash. The interest rate to borrow this excess money begins a bidding battle between different lenders each competing for the loan funds. Just like the most of us, borrowers go for the lowest price.

Interest Rates and A Growing Economy

When the economy is growing, consumers gain confidence, as their confidence grows people start spending money. What do they buy? Everything under the sun but consumer goods are the term you will hear most often. People buy items like cars, computers, appliances like stainless steel refrigerators, etc.

As demand for products increase, or more people in the "I want that item" product pool, companies can begin to charge more for their products. As companies begin to make more profits it is not long before workers begin asking for more benefits and more money in their paychecks. As companies meet worker demands, the company experiences increased cost and expenses then inflation begins.

Inflation is very complicated to describe, however, inflation can send the economy into a tailspin causing all types of money triggers to be pulled. To slow down any inflation the Fed does the opposite of buying bonds and begins selling bonds on the market. Before the Fed was putting money in the economy, by selling bonds for cash the Fed is now pulling money OUT of the economy and holding cash. Less available cash on the open market means borrowers must bid up the interest rate to borrow, which slows down the economic buying frenzy and keeps the economy at a manageable pace or level.
